What is the Consent for Treatment of a Minor?

The Consent for Treatment of a Minor form is a crucial document used to obtain parental approval for minors under the age of 19 to receive counseling and psychiatric care. It is particularly significant in situations where minors require mental health services from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ln's Counseling and Psychological Services (CAPS).

Parents or guardians of minors under the age of 19 are eligible to sign the Consent for Treatment of a Minor form, granting permission for counseling services.
Consent can be revoked at any time by the parent or guardian. It's advisable to submit a written request to CAPS to ensure the revocation is formally acknowledged.
Once completed, the form can be submitted directly through pdfFiller or printed and delivered to the Counseling and Psychological Services office at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ln.
There are typically no fees associated with the completion or submission of the Consent for Treatment of a Minor form, but check with CAPS for specifics.
You will need the student's name, ID, and signatures from both the student and the parent or guardian. Ensure you have up-to-date contact information as well.
Common mistakes include missing signatures, incorrect dates, or inaccurate student information. Always double-check the entries before final submission.
The consent remains valid until the minor turns 19 years old unless revoked earlier by the parent or guardian. Review the validity period regularly.
